### Runbook: Tax-rate lookup cache (Quillbury)

Quick refresher for the sync: the tax-rate cache in Quillbury warms itself from the Fennic rates feed every hour. If lookups start returning stale brackets, don't panic — just flush the cache pod and let it rehydrate, which takes about two minutes. Worst case, bump the TTL down temporarily. The cache behavior is all driven by config, and here's what it's currently set to.

service settings:
[casax]
port = 6379
team = rusir
host = casax.zemvarhq.corp
region = outer-4
access_code = ac_9808ce
timeout_ms = 1500

## Changelog — Spoolhaven v2.9.0

Completed the scheduled rotation of the deploy key for the Spoolhaven printer-spooler microservice. The previous key was revoked at rollout; all queue workers in the Derrin cluster were redeployed and verified. No job loss observed. Release manager: please update the pipeline trust store with the key below.

deploy key for bawig-tajop: bky9_PQ3GVoQw1

Minutes — Management Meeting, Expansion into the Corvane Basin Region

Present: CEO, CFO, COO, Regional Lead.

1. Site survey for Dunnavar depot complete; permits pending.
2. Staffing plan approved: 14 hires in phase one.
3. CFO flagged currency exposure; hedging proposal due next meeting.
4. Launch timeline held at Q2.
5. Competitor activity by Ostrell Freight noted; monitoring assigned to Regional Lead.

The board's attention is drawn to the confidential planning note below.

management briefing: Project Ulavan slips by two quarters because of the staffing delay.

## Runbook: Account recovery — Lagwatch replica alarm

Plugin authors: if your Lagwatch integration account is locked after repeated auth failures, the replica-lag alarm keeps firing with stale data. Do not silence the alarm; recover the account first. Steps: stop your poller, wait one lockout window, re-register the plugin, confirm lag metrics resume. If self-service recovery fails, the fallback console will prompt you, and it accepts the recovery passphrase given below.

strongbox words: wenix-ulador